Cristiane Lucena, who prefers to go by Cris, is a Brazilian-born attorney with over two decades of experience navigating complex legal systems across two continents. She began her legal career in Brazil as a labor and employment attorney, and she also clerked for justices at the Labor Regional Court in Paraná. After relocating to the United States, Cris earned her Master of Laws (LL.M.) in U.S. law from the University of Houston Law Center (UHLC) in 2020 and passed the Texas Bar Exam during the height of the COVID-19 pandemic. Cris discovered her passion for immigration law while working as a student attorney at UHLC, where she advocated for vulnerable individuals facing overwhelming legal challenges. Since then, she has dedicated her career to immigration law, proudly supporting diverse communities—including Afghan nationals paroled into the U.S. due to the 2021 U.S. withdrawal from Afghanistan. Her work is marked by compassion, diligence, and a deep understanding of the immigrant experience. In 2023, Cris moved to Philadelphia and joined Hykel Law in May 2025. She is excited to continue helping immigrants achieve stability and opportunity, with a special commitment to serving the Brazilian community in the Philadelphia area.
